As a Channel Account Manager at Instructure, Inc., you will align with Channel Partners to achieve sales quota attainment and ensure the delivery of exceptional customer experiences. You will use consultative and strategic selling skills, leveraging a strong understanding of the Educational Technology industry. The successful candidate will help Channel Partners meet channel program expectations and uphold the Canvas brand by delivering a world-class customer experience.

What you will do

  • Discover and manage sales opportunities with all designated partners in your region, providing accurate and updated sales funnel reports with current status

  • Provide accurate and detailed weekly, monthly, and quarterly forecasts of identified and proposed opportunities to meet or exceed quota requirements, in Salesforce

  • Manage and execute the Partner planning document

  • Meet with Partners, participate in joint sales calls to customers, and assist the Partner in closing opportunities

  • Help Partners broaden their product expertise and expand sales opportunities, driving growth from all associated resources

  • Train partners on products, processes, and effective sales techniques

  • Escalate pricing, SLA, or other issues as needed

  • Coordinate Partner access to Sales Engineering, Field Marketing, and overlay resources as appropriate

  • Disseminate all communications and announcements to Partners

  • Coordinate participation in local Partner events and training

  • Drive products, promotions, and programs with Partners

  • Attend shows and conference calls, as designated by management

  • Read and stay up to date on all communications, maintaining high product, program, and promotion knowledge

  • Manage tasks to completion per project schedule or direction from management

  • Lead the maintenance of up-to-date information on company websites, such as webinar recordings, price lists, channel partners, and contact information

  • Support the development of collateral related to Instructure sales for Channel Partners
